I've had mine for four years and have made mods to all four of my Audis. Also, if you have someone else do it for you, sometimes some mods get reset to default if Audi service does a software upgrade and you have to start over. Owning your own cable makes it easy to redo your changes.

Sure, so long as you follow the instructions from other Vag-Com owners who post the info. What you don't want to do is start messing around with software settings when you don't know what you're doing.

Check out the A6 Vag-Com thread - most of the common mods are listed or with links to other sites with directions. No computer science degree is necessary, just a PC laptop or Mac Book with Windows virtual loaded. The VCDS (Vag-Com) software is free once you have the cable. Stay away from eBay Vag-Com "cables" as they are not fully engineered with the proper firmware. Pig in a poke.
